What Happens When Flame Meets Metal
1. The Bounce Effect
Most candles sit in containers that absorb light, such as ceramic, plain glass, or matte finishes.
These materials drink up more light than they give back. Metallic glass candles, however, work backwards: their surfaces grab light and throw it everywhere.
Consequently, one flame suddenly becomes dozens of tiny light sources bouncing off walls, ceilings, and tabletops.
Here's the breakdown:
● Smooth metal creates mirror-like reflections at sharp angles.
● Textured surfaces scatter light in softer, wider patterns.
● Gold, silver, and copper tones shift the color of the light itself.
A single shiny candle can outperform three regular ones simply because of how much light gets recycled through reflection.
2. Movement Catches the Eye
Candle flames never hold still; they sway with the smallest air current.
On a reflective surface, that tiny movement spreads across the whole room, causing shadows to shift and light patterns to dance on the walls.
Human eyes automatically track movement; it’s a hardwired survival instinct.
Yet, flickering candlelight on metal does the opposite of triggering stress. The movement is just interesting enough to hold attention without demanding it, similar to watching waves or leaves rustling in the wind.

Where You Put Them Changes Everything
1. Smart Placement Multiplies Impact
Drop a candle anywhere and it gives off light.
Put it in the right spot and it transforms the whole space. Corners are the best in this regard.
Two walls meeting create natural amplifiers; light bounces back and forth, pushing into areas that usually stay dim.
One candle in a corner can light up zones that would normally need two or three sources.
Near mirrors work well too, but avoid placing them directly facing the glass, as that creates glare. Angle them so reflections multiply without blinding anyone who walks by.
If you stack them at different heights, the light beams cross through space, building layers.

Pretty Surfaces That Actually Work
1. Beyond Looks
Metal coatings do real work. They change how heat behaves. Instead of escaping through the glass, some thermal energy bounces back into the wax, which creates more even melting and
results in less waste stuck to the sides when the candle burns down. Reflective surfaces also stay cooler than dark ones.
A black ceramic vessel soaks up heat, while a metallic one reflects it. Touch both after burning for an hour, and the difference is obvious. This makes premium metallic candles safer around curious hands and paws.

2. Quality That Lasts
Cheap metallic paint flakes off after a few uses. Real quality uses vacuum metallization or
electroplating.
These processes bond metal to glass at a molecular level, meaning heat won't strip it and
handling won't scratch it away. The vessels keep working after the wax runs out, too.
